“These are the visions that Isaiah son of Amoz saw concerning Judah and Jerusalem. He saw these visions during the years when Uzziah, Jotham, Ahaz, and Hezekiah were kings of Judah.” Isaiah 1:1

“It was in the year King Uzziah died that I saw the Lord. He was sitting on a lofty throne, and the train of his robe filled the Temple. Attending him were mighty seraphim, each having six wings. With two wings they covered their faces, with two they covered their feet, and with two they flew. They were calling out to each other, “Holy, holy, holy is the Lord of Heaven’s Armies!
The whole earth is filled with his glory! Their voices shook the Temple to its foundations, and the entire building was filled with smoke.” Isaiah 6:1-4 NLT


Awesome God,

The vision must have taken up all of his line of sight from floor to heavens heights. Just the train of Your robe God filled the enormous Temple in Jerusalem. The Temple was built 30 cubits high which equates to 45 feet, which I believe equates to a 4 to 5 story building! I wonder how big the angels were then! And 6 wings! They cover their faces with two for humility not to take attention from You, God? They are not to be worshipped. Two more wings enable them to go and do Your bidding? And two wings on their feet to speed them on their way or to keep them from earthly dust and sin? The Temple, a massive structure shook as if an earthquake. Or was there a real earthquake too? I would probably have had a heart attack, or at least panicked and maybe fainted.

Some people experience Your presence and some even claim to have seen angels. For those of us who have not, we have these glimpses through Your Word. We may have been moved to tears or felt our heart beating faster. One thing is for sure it makes us stop and know that something important is beginning. You have our full attention. Isaiah saw it, wrote about it but did not live see it. But he got his own glimpse of Your future.

Father, we are feeble and we need assurance, encouragement and to know You are with us. Thank You for Your Spirit within us. And the reminder that You are greater than our imagination, greater than creation and yet You deign to want to be a part of our lives.

In Jesus name we pray, Amen.
